The cinema concert for the 50th film in the 'Otoko wa Tsurai yo' series, which has enveloped Japan in laughter and tears, 'Otoko wa Tsurai yo: Welcome Back, Tora-san', will be held on Saturday, June 20, at the Aichi Prefectural Arts Theater Main Hall.

The 'Otoko wa Tsurai yo: Welcome Back, Tora-san' cinema concert premiered in June 2024 at Tokyo International Forum Hall A, captivating an audience of approximately 5,000 people. It was met with great acclaim, enveloped in unending applause and cheers even after the performance ended.

Reflecting on that time, Director Yoji Yamada said:

"It was truly a wonderful performance. The applause and cheers wouldn't stop, even after it ended. Even after I left the stage, I was called back, and the applause continued. I was enveloped in an extraordinary emotion, wondering how long it would go on. I remember it vividly even now."

Furthermore, regarding that excitement, he reflected:

"I think it was a gathering of comrades who love 'Tora-san', a feeling of fellowship that we were all glad to see 'Tora-san' again together. That became the unending applause."

The 'Otoko wa Tsurai yo' film series, from its first film in 1969 to the 50th film 'Otoko wa Tsurai yo: Welcome Back, Tora-san' released in 2019, is a brilliant national series in Japanese film history.

The protagonist, Kuruma Torajiro, commonly known as 'Tora-san', travels around Japan, casually returns to his hometown of Shibamata, and causes trouble involving his family and the women he falls in love with. He is unconventional and free-spirited. However, his warm and kind personality has captured the hearts of many people and has been loved for many years.

'Otoko wa Tsurai yo: Welcome Back, Tora-san' is a miraculous work that interweaves newly filmed footage of the characters in the 'present' with footage from past series revived through 4K digital restoration, weaving them into a single story.

In the cinema concert, the film's dialogue and sound effects remain, but the musical parts are performed live by a full orchestra in sync with the entire film screening. This offers a unique emotional experience unlike a movie theater or a concert hall.

Aiming for the upcoming Nagoya performance, Director Yamada sent the following message to fans in Nagoya:

"I hope you will come to the theater, listen to the live orchestra, and enjoy watching Tora-san's movie once again. And I hope you will experience the same strange, almost 'extraordinary' emotion that I experienced at the Tokyo International Forum."

Performance Overview

'Otoko wa Tsurai yo: Welcome Back, Tora-san' Cinema Concert

[Nagoya Performance]

Date & Time: Sunday, June 20, 2026, Doors open 14:00 / Performance starts 15:00

Venue: Aichi Prefectural Arts Theater, Main Hall

Screened Film:

'Otoko wa Tsurai yo: Welcome Back, Tora-san' (Released 2019, 50th film)

Running Time: Approximately 2 hours 20 minutes (including intermission)

Original Story & Director: Yoji Yamada / Screenplay: Yoji Yamada, Yuzo Asahara / Music: Naozumi Yamamoto, Junnosuke Yamamoto

Film Cast:

Kiyoshi Atsumi / Chieko Baisho, Hidetaka Yoshioka, Kumiko Goto, Gin Maeda, Chizuru Ikewaki, Mari Natsuki, Ruriko Asaoka

Jun Miho, Gajiro Sato, Hiyori Sakurada, Masayasu Kitayama, Takeyama Kannyaku, Mari Hamada, Tetsuro Degawa, Taiki Matsuno, Tamahei Hayashiya

Shiraku Tachikawa, Koshiro Kobayashi, Takashi Sasano, Isao Hashizume

Concert Cast:

Conductor: Tsutomu Iwamura

Orchestra: Chubu Philharmonic Orchestra

*Note: Film staff and cast will not appear or be on stage.

Ticket Price (tax included, all reserved seats): 11,000 yen

*Children under 3 years old are not permitted entry.
